UCLG ASPAC Manifesto 2020-2025 Incorporated Fuzhou’s Proposal

TIME:2021-01-29 14:44

    On the afternoon of Jan. 27 (Beijing time), Secretariat of United Cities and Local Governments Asia-Pacific (UCLG ASPAC) convened the Third Meeting of Development Committee on Manifesto 2020-2025 (the Manifesto) and invited the Committee members to have in-depth exchanges on Draft of the Manifesto. Secretariat of 21st-Century Maritime Cooperation Committee attended the meeting. Chaired by Dr. Bernadia, Secretary General of UCLG ASPAC, the meeting successively discussed the date of formal adoption of the Manifesto, the contents added to the previous draft and new contents to be added to the current draft. Local Government New Zealand, All India Institute of Local Self-Government, Makati City of the Philippines, Chinese People’s Association for Friendship with Foreign Countries, Zhengzhou City, Fuzhou City, Taipei City and other representatives of members spoke in turns and put forward relevant opinions and suggestions.

       In reference to the Draft Zero, Fuzhou City previously proposed to add contents concerning maritime cooperation to further promote the development of marine economy, advance the construction of smart oceans, and foster the conservation of fishery resources and marine environment. The proposal has been adopted by the Secretariat of UCLG ASPAC and has been fully embodied in the current Manifesto.
